We very much enjoyed our stay at this property, especially being so close to town and enjoyed walks along the river to Regatta Meadow on a rare sunny few days in October.
There are steep steps up to the apartment outside (approximately 8 steps) the apartment is on the ground floor once you are inside.
Kitchen is extremely small, but had all the equipment we needed. For those that want to eat out there is a Turkish, 2 Indian and 2 Italian restaurants within a few steps of the property all serving lovely food (check trip advisor for reviews). There is also easy access to banks, a coffee shop, a lovely tea room and an Iceland. Tesco supermarket is about a 20 minute walk/5 minute drive away.
Property has a lounge with dining table in it and kitchen downstairs and 2 bedrooms and a bathroom upstairs. All equipment required is provided i.e. iron and ironing board, hairdryer and a TV in each bedroom if it is important to you (as well as the lounge).
